What is a Mid Consistency Pulper?
A **mid consistency pulper** is a type of industrial machine used in the paper manufacturing process. It operates at a consistency level that typically ranges from 3% to 15% fiber content. This consistency level is particularly advantageous because it balances the need for effective fiber separation and the viscosity of the slurry, making it easier for downstream processes to handle. Mid consistency pulpers are utilized for various raw materials, including recycled paper, wood chips, and other fibrous materials, providing versatility in production.
How Mid Consistency Pulpers Work
The operational mechanics of a mid consistency pulper involve several stages that work synergistically to achieve optimal results:
1. Feeding the Raw Material
The process begins with the **feeding of raw materials** into the pulper. These materials often include waste paper or wood chips, which are introduced into the machine through a feed chute. The feed rate is carefully controlled to maintain the desired consistency level.
2. Mechanical Disintegration
Once inside the pulper, the raw materials undergo **mechanical disintegration**. High-powered rotors or impellers create turbulence, breaking down the fibers into smaller particles. This step is crucial for facilitating the separation of fibers and removing contaminants.
3. Hydration and Slurry Formation
As the fibers are disintegrated, water is introduced to the mixture, resulting in the formation of a slurry. The **hydration process** is essential for ensuring that the fibers can be easily manipulated in subsequent processing stages.
4. Fiber Separation
During the pulping phase, the machine also incorporates separation mechanisms that allow for the removal of non-fibrous contaminants. These contaminants might include plastics, metals, or other foreign materials that could affect the quality of the final product.
5. Discharge of Pulp
Once the fibers are adequately separated and the slurry reaches the desired consistency, the pulper discharges the pulp for further processing. This pulp can then be processed into various paper products or subjected to additional treatments as required.
Advantages of Mid Consistency Pulpers
Mid consistency pulpers offer several notable advantages that enhance their appeal within the paper manufacturing industry:
1. Improved Efficiency
Operating at mid consistency levels allows for **enhanced efficiency** in the pulping process. The balance between fiber content and water facilitates quicker processing times, reducing energy consumption and overall production costs.
2. Versatility in Raw Material Usage
Mid consistency pulpers can handle a variety of raw materials, making them suitable for both recycling and virgin fiber applications. This versatility ensures that manufacturers can adapt to fluctuating market demands.
3. Higher Quality Pulp
The mechanical action of mid consistency pulpers results in **higher quality pulp** with improved fiber separation and reduced contamination levels. This quality translates to better performance in downstream paper production processes.
4. Eco-Friendly Operations
Utilizing mid consistency pulpers can contribute to more sustainable manufacturing practices. By effectively recycling materials and reducing water usage, these machines promote eco-friendly operations within the paper industry.
Key Components of Mid Consistency Pulpers
To fully grasp the functionality of mid consistency pulpers, it's essential to understand their key components:
1. Rotor and Impeller
The **rotor and impeller** system is responsible for creating the mechanical action necessary for fiber disintegration. These components are designed for durability and efficiency, often made from high-strength materials.
2. Feed System
The **feed system** regulates the introduction of raw materials into the pulper. It ensures that the correct amount of fibers is processed at a consistent rate, contributing to optimal slurry formation.
3. Water Supply System
A reliable **water supply system** is critical for maintaining the desired consistency level during the pulping process. This system needs to be efficient, as water usage directly impacts production costs and environmental concerns.
4. Discharge Mechanism
The **discharge mechanism** allows for the efficient removal of processed pulp from the machine, ensuring that production flows smoothly into subsequent stages.
5. Control Panel
Modern mid consistency pulpers are equipped with a **control panel** that allows operators to monitor and adjust various parameters during operation. This feature enhances the overall management of the pulping process.
Applications of Mid Consistency Pulpers in the Paper Industry
Mid consistency pulpers are utilized in various applications across the paper industry, including:
1. Recycled Paper Production
The ability to efficiently process recycled materials makes mid consistency pulpers ideal for facilities focused on producing recycled paper products. They aid in maintaining quality while utilizing waste materials effectively.
2. Tissue Paper Manufacturing
In the production of tissue paper, mid consistency pulpers play a crucial role in ensuring the pulp meets the desired softness and absorbency requirements.
3. Packaging Materials
Mid consistency pulpers are also employed in the manufacturing of packaging materials, where they help produce strong and durable paper products that meet industry standards.
Maintenance and Optimization of Mid Consistency Pulpers
To ensure the longevity and efficiency of mid consistency pulpers, regular maintenance is essential. Here are several key practices:
1. Regular Inspections
Conducting **regular inspections** of all components helps identify wear and tear before they lead to significant issues. Operators should check the rotor, impeller, and feed systems routinely.
2. Lubrication of Moving Parts
Proper **lubrication** of moving parts reduces friction and wear, ensuring smooth operation. Following the manufacturer’s recommendations for lubrication intervals is critical.
3. Cleaning Protocols
Implementing **cleaning protocols** to remove contaminants and buildup is vital for maintaining the quality of the pulp and preventing operational disruptions.
4. Performance Monitoring
Utilizing performance monitoring systems can help track the efficiency of the pulper. This data can inform adjustments to optimize production and reduce downtime.
